Connected Adds Second Executive Role to Drive Startup's Ambitious Targets


Canada's leading product development firm and LinkedIn top startup Connected appoints seasoned marketing leader Tammy Chiasson to EVP Growth & Client Experience

TORONTO, Dec. 12 , 2018 /CNW/ - Recently chosen by LinkedIn as one of the Top 25 Startups in Canada, the rapidly growing product development firm Connected is introducing a new senior function—Executive Vice President, Growth & Client Experience—to drive the startup's ambitious goal of creating and leading a new category of consultancy: the product development firm.

Tammy Chiasson, EVP Growth & Client Experience (CNW Group/Connected)

Appointed to this newfound position is Tammy Chiasson, a seasoned marketer, strategist, and all-around business leader with more than 17 years experience on both client and agency sides. Chiasson has held many leadership roles, and has extensive background in brand and customer experience, digital transformation, and product development. Her promotion to EVP Growth & Client Experience follows a string of promotions last month—including the appointment of Connected Cofounder, Damian McCabe, to EVP Product Development.

"Since joining in 2017 to advise and support our Marketing Team, Tammy has had a tremendous impact, whether by shaping and leading our successful rebrand, creating a partnership with Elevate and organizing one of the festival's most successful talk tracks, Elevate Product, or by stewarding our strategic planning prcess," said Mike Stern, Connected Cofounder and CEO. "Beyond her wealth of experience, Tammy is a trusted builder at heart, and we are so excited to have her in this new role."



Chiasson has a proven ability to mobilize and align teams to achieve business results during times of ambiguity and change, and has a track record of driving aggressive growth through diligent client service. Hailing from Tangerine, where Chiasson led the launch of multiple large-scale digital product initiatives across banking and retail (leading engineering, design and product teams across multi-year programs), Chiasson will work closely with Stern and McCabe to deliver client impact across all services and verticals.

Prior to her tenure at Tangerine, Chiasson was the Head of Brand Experience, Digital and Measurement at one of Canada's leading full-service agencies, john st., where she was a trusted advisor to some of Canada's most ambitious CEOs on their brand, digital strategy and communications programs. At Tangerine, Chiasson hired best-in-class service providers and worked closely with brands like McKinsey, Deloitte Digital, Artefact, and XPlane to drive growth and client service.

In her new role, Chiasson's key responsibilities will be:

  • Growing the Connected business in ways that drive the company towards its vision

  • Determining where-to-play in chosen markets and how to go-to-market ("service-market fit")

  • Establishing a winning service design in partnership with Damian McCabe, Cofounder & EVP of Product Development

  • Aggregate demand planning, reporting and forecasting

Part of Connected's journey toward creating a truly product-centric firm requires a continuous commitment to evolution and improvement, much like the software products they help develop.

Since its inception four years ago, Connected has doubled in size year over year. To service its many clients, the company has grown from 83 to 162 employees in the last 12 months alone. 100% employee owned, Connected has also won a number of awards, including being named one of Canada's Top Small and Medium Employers (two years in a row) according to The Globe and Mail and being named one of LinkedIn's Top Startups in Canada.
